I returned to the vet today to get my second vaccinations and my microchip. I had vocal practice all the way there. That was lots and lots of fun.

But, once again, I was an excellent patient as evidenced by my photos.

 

Cooper Murphy has 2nd vet visit.

 

That’s Dr. Neel with me in the center photo. She was getting ready to listen to my heart. She even let me touch the chestpiece on her stethoscope with my paw. I purred through my entire exam, which I passed with an A+. I maybe gained a tad too much weight, but I didn’t get in trouble…yet. I weighed 12.1 pounds a month ago and 13.5 pounds today.

I was a bit more quiet on the trip home, but I still had plenty to say. I have become quite a talker letting the parental units know when I want to go out on the catio and then come in again.
